body {
	text-align					:				center;
	background-image			: 				url(../images/hg_D1DBE4_vertical.gif);
	background-repeat			: 				repeat-x;
	margin						:				0 0 0 0;
	padding: 0 0 0 0;
	background-color			:				#F8F6F7;	
}

#haupt_container{
	margin						:				auto;	
	width						:				960px;
	height						: 				auto;
	top							: 				0px;
	height						: 				100%;
}


/**********************************************************
*KOPF
***************************************************************/
#kopf_header {
	float						: 				center;
	height						: 				auto;
	width						: 				958px;	
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	border-left					:				1px solid #9B9CA0;	
	border-right				:				1px solid #9B9CA0;	
	
}
#blueline {
	float						: 				left;
	height						: 				5px;
	width						: 				958px;
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	border-bottom				:				1px solid #9B9CA0;
	background-color			:				#061654;	
	
}
*html #blueline {
	height						: 				6px;
}
#logo {
	float						: 				left;
	height						: 				80px;
	width						: 				190px;
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	border-bottom				:				1px solid #9B9CA0;
	border-right				:				1px solid #9B9CA0;
	
	
}
*html #logo {
	height						: 				81px;
}
#sprache {
	float						: 				left;
	height						: 				53px;
	width						: 				767px;
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	border-bottom				:				1px solid #9B9CA0;
	text-align					: 				right;
	background-color			:				#ffffff;
}
*html #sprache {
	width						: 				766px;
	height						: 				54px;
}

#topnavi {
	float						: 				left;
	height						: 				26px;
	width						: 				767px;
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	border-bottom				:				1px solid #9B9CA0;
	background-color			:				#F8F6F7;	
	text-align					: 				right;
}	

*html #topnavi {
	width						: 				766px;
	height						: 				27px;
}

#kopfbild {
	float						: 				left;
	height						: 				197px;
	width						: 				958px;
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	border-bottom				:				1px solid #9B9CA0;
	
}
*html #kopfbild {
	height						: 				198px;
}
#mainnavi {
	float						: 				left;
	height						: 				26px;
	width						: 				958px;
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	border-bottom				:				1px solid #9B9CA0;
	background-color			:				#061654;	
	text-align					: 				left;
}

				
*html #mainnavi {
	height						: 				27px;
}


	

/***********************************************************
printNsearch
****************************************************************/
	
#printNsearch {
	float						: 				center;
	height						: 				26px;
	width						: 				958px;
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	background-color			:				#D1DBE4;	
	border-bottom				:				1px solid #9B9CA0;
	border-right				:				1px solid #9B9CA0;
	border-left					:				1px solid #9B9CA0;
	
	
}
*html #printNsearch {
	height						: 				27px;
}
#print {
	float						: 				left;
	height						: 				26px;
	width						: 				767px;
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	border-right				:				1px solid #9B9CA0;
	text-align					: 				right;
	
	
}
*html #print {
	width						: 				768px;
}
#search {
	float						: 				left;
	height						: 				26px;
	width						: 				190px;
	overflow					: 				hidden;
	margin						: 				0 0 0 0;
	text-align					: 				center;
}
#search_text {
	margin						: 				2 2 2 2;
	text-align					: 				right;
	vertical-align				: 				middle;
}

*html #search {
	width						: 				187px;
}
.tx-indexedsearch-searchbox{
	display: hidden;
}
/***********************************************************
CONTENT
************************************************************/

#content {
	float						: 				center;
	height						: 				auto;
	width						: 				958px;
	overflow					: 				hidden;
	margin						: 				0 0 15px 0;
	background-image			: 				url(../images/hg_hor_2.gif);
	background-repeat			: 				repeat-y;
	background-color			:				#F8F6F7;
	border-bottom				:				1px solid #9B9CA0;
	border-right				:				1px solid #9B9CA0;
	border-left					:				1px solid #9B9CA0;
	
}
#contentlinks {
	float						: 				left;
	width						: 				767px;
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	border-right				:				1px solid #9B9CA0;
	text-align					: 				left;
	background-color			:				#ffffff;
	
	
}



*html #contentlinks {
	width						: 				768px;
}
#contentrechts {
	float						: 				left;
	width						: 				190px;
	overflow					: 				hidden;
	margin						: 				0 0 0px 0;
	text-align					: 				center;
}
*html #contentrechts {
	width						: 				187px;
}

	
		

#fusszeile {	
	
	float						:				center;	
	width						: 				958px;	
	clear						: 				both;
	color						:				#9B9CA0;
	font-family					: 				Arial, Verdana, Helvetica, sans-serif;
	font-size					: 				12px;
	
}



a:visited {
	
	text-decoration: underline;
}
a:hover {
	
	text-decoration: underline;
}
a:link {
	
	text-decoration: underline;
}
th {
	vertical-align: top;
}
